CVE-2016-7048

HIGHCVSS 8.1/10EPSS 4.92%

Last modified

CVE-2016-7048 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 8.1/10 on the CVSS scale. The interactive installer in PostgreSQL before 9.3.15, 9.4.x before 9.4.10, and 9.5.x before 9.5.5 might all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by leveraging use of HTTP to download software.. EPSS estimates a 4.92%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
